Chris Brown pleads guilty in DC assault case, is sentenced to time already served
   Chris Brown pleads guilty in DC assault case, is sentenced to time already served

Nothing can cramp your style more than a jail sentence right before you have to go on tour to promote your new album that was already delayed numerous times because you were busy spending time either in courts or in jail. Chris Brown learned that the hard way for himself.

TMZ reports that the singer was present today in court in regard to his DC assault case in which he was charged with a misdemeanor for punching a man in the face outside the W Hotel. Brown decided to play ball and accepted the plea deal, which meant that he was to plead guilty.

His decision was explained to the judge in the sincerest of forms, as Brown took the stand and explained that he just wanted this case to go away so that he can be free to go on tour. Naturally, this had a positive effect, since admitting the crime is always a good idea in court.

As a consequence, Brown was sentenced to time already served in jail, which meant that Brown was free to go home and also resolved the last of his legal matters.

What's interesting is that Brown only served 2 days in a DC jail, but he ended up doing 108 days in a Los Angeles County jail because his DC case constituted a violation of his probation that was started in connection with the Rihanna punching case.

The judge considered that Brown learned his lesson and allowed him to go home. Brown made a solid case in court, apologizing for his actions and pointing out that this case derailed his career for the past year.
